Welcome to the charming city of Dawson, located in Terrell County, Georgia, USA. Nestled in the heart of the state, Dawson offers a warm and inviting community with a rich history and a promising future.

With its small-town charm and friendly atmosphere, Dawson is a great place to call home. The city is known for its close-knit community, where neighbors become friends and everyone is welcomed with open arms. The residents take pride in their city and work together to maintain its beauty and heritage.

Dawson boasts a range of amenities and attractions for residents and visitors alike. Nature enthusiasts will appreciate the city's proximity to outdoor recreational areas, such as the nearby Lake Blackshear, where they can enjoy boating, fishing, and hiking. The city also offers a variety of parks, perfect for picnicking or leisurely strolls.

For those seeking a taste of history, Dawson is home to several historic sites and landmarks. The Terrell County Courthouse, built in 1892, is a beautiful example of Victorian architecture and serves as a reminder of the city's past. The Dawson Historic District, listed on the National Register of Historic Places, showcases the city's rich history through its well-preserved buildings and structures.
